Pirates ace Paul Skenes nominated for Roberto Clemente Award
Paul Skenes, a standout player for the Pirates, has been nominated for the prestigious Roberto Clemente Award, which honors players who demonstrate excellence both on and off the field. This nomination is significant as it highlights Skenes' contributions to the game and his community, reflecting the values of one of baseball's greatest legends.
